Babbo (39 Albemarle Street, London, W1S 4JQ) One of the new great restaurants in London, will soon get in the TOP 10 list. The food is really fresh and there is so many choices in the menu that you will need a help from the waiters (great by the way). We start with a fresh burrata, not the dry ones that you will find around London, this is something that worth the visit, big, juice and creamy burrata… I’m a huge fan of cheeses but this one is the best in London. Was looking to indulge myself so got a Lasagna, was crispy on top and really moist inside….Amazing. My girlfriend had a summer salad, colorful and look really healthy compared with my burrata… but no worries she them got a Veal Milanese, could not resist and helped her out to finish… After all this extravagance we shared a simple and well done tiramisu, was very good… The manager even offer us a small glass of sweet wine to finish… service is good… Italians everywhere… I recommend this restaurant…
